Parisavant is a French website that publishes photos of street scenes in Paris taken in the past and today. So you can see side-by-side how streets, squares and buildings have changed (for better or worse).

If you are in Languedoc-Roussillon or Provence, don’t miss the Pont du Gard outside Uzès, near Nîmes and Arles.
